Fallow Restaurant Group is looking for a talented Junior Editorial Chef to assist on the planning and delivery of the rapidly growing publishing arm of the Fallow Group, with Substack as the core focus. Having launched at the end of February of this year, The Fallow Chefs Substack is one of the fastest growing Substack publications in recent years, with close to 10,000 subscribers in just over 2 months.
We're looking for someone who is a proficient cook (ideally with professional restaurant experience) and excellent written communicator (ideally with experience in food writing) to undertake the management and delivery of the Substack content, reporting in to the Editorial Chef.
Each Substack post will require the individual to manage and interview key stakeholders and deliver articles (c.1,500 words) centred around Jack and Will's background and journey plus in depth food science and technique. They'll also need to rework and test recipes (including taking process photographs) to make them relevant for a domestic context.
